program fungction
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
import java.util.Scanner;
public class tokoperkakas {
public static void main(String[] args) {
Scanner input = new Scanner (System.in);
BufferedReader input2 = new BufferedReader (new InputStreamReader (System.in));
int i = 0;
int hargatotal = 0;
int penampung = 0;
String menu[] = new String [100];
int harga[] = new int [100];
String keputusan="Y";
System.out.println("-------------------------------");
System.out.println("TOKO PERKAKAS");
System.out.println("-------------------------------");
System.out.println("MENJUAL BERBAGAI MACAM PERKAKAS DAN BAHAN BANGUNAN DENGAN HARGA MURAH");
System.out.println("=============================== ");
System.out.println("Daftar PERKAKAS yang kami jual");
System.out.println("=============================== ");
System.out.println("1.obeng = Rp 12.000 ");
System.out.println("2. tang kecil = Rp 9.500 ");
System.out.println("3. mata bor = Rp 7.000 ");
System.out.println("4. tang ukuran sedang = Rp 14.000");
System.out.println("5. skrup = Rp 3.000");
System.out.println("6. bor = Rp 80.000 ");
System.out.println("7. obeng listrik = Rp 35.000 ");
System.out.println("8. kunci inggris = Rp 40.000 ");
System.out.println("9. gergaji = Rp 10.000");
System.out.println("10. batu bata = Rp 3.000");
while (keputusan.equals("Y")||keputusan.equals("y"))
{
System.out.print("Pilih dengan memasukan angka yang tersedia pada menu = ");
int pil = input.nextInt();
if (pil==1){
menu[i] = "obeng";
harga[i] = 12000;
} else if (pil==2) {
menu[i]= "tang kecil";
harga[i] = 9500;
} else if (pil==3) {
menu[i]="mata bor";
harga[i] = 7000;
} else if (pil==4) {
menu[i]= "tang ukuran sedang";
harga[i] = 14000;
} else if (pil==5) {
menu[i]= "skrup";
harga[i] = 3000;
} else if (pil==6) {
menu[i]= "bor";
harga[i] = 80000;
} else if (pil==7) {
menu[i]= "obeng listrik";
harga[i] = 35000;
} else if (pil==8) {
menu[i]= "kunci inggris";
harga[i] = 40000;
} else if (pil==9) {
menu[i]= "gergaji";
harga[i] = 10000;
} else if (pil==10) {
menu[i]= "batu bata";
harga[i] = 3000;
} else {
System.out.println("Maaf barang yang anda pilih tidak tersedia ");
menu[i]= "Tidak Ada";
}
System.out.println("barang yang anda pesan adalah : "+menu[i]);
System.out.println("Yang harus anda bayar adalah : "+harga[i]);
System.out.print("Apakah anda ingin membeli lagi ? Y/T : ");
try{
keputusan = input2.readLine();
}catch(IOException e){
System.out.println("Gagal Membaca Keyboard");
}
i++;
}
System.out.println("Menu yang anda pesan adalah : "+i);
for (int a = 0; a<i;a++){
System.out.print(menu[a]+", ");
}
for (int b = 0; b<i;b++){
hargatotal = hargatotal + harga[b];
}
System.out.println("Total yang harus anda bayar adalah : Rp."+hargatotal);
}
}
import java.io.IOException;
import java.io.InputStreamReader;
import java.util.Scanner;
public class tokoperkakas {
public static void main(String[] args) {
Scanner input = new Scanner (System.in);
BufferedReader input2 = new BufferedReader (new InputStreamReader (System.in));
int i = 0;
int hargatotal = 0;
int penampung = 0;
String menu[] = new String [100];
int harga[] = new int [100];
String keputusan="Y";
System.out.println("-------------------------------");
System.out.println("TOKO PERKAKAS");
System.out.println("-------------------------------");
System.out.println("MENJUAL BERBAGAI MACAM PERKAKAS DAN BAHAN BANGUNAN DENGAN HARGA MURAH");
System.out.println("=============================== ");
System.out.println("Daftar PERKAKAS yang kami jual");
System.out.println("=============================== ");
System.out.println("1.obeng = Rp 12.000 ");
System.out.println("2. tang kecil = Rp 9.500 ");
System.out.println("3. mata bor = Rp 7.000 ");
System.out.println("4. tang ukuran sedang = Rp 14.000");
System.out.println("5. skrup = Rp 3.000");
System.out.println("6. bor = Rp 80.000 ");
System.out.println("7. obeng listrik = Rp 35.000 ");
System.out.println("8. kunci inggris = Rp 40.000 ");
System.out.println("9. gergaji = Rp 10.000");
System.out.println("10. batu bata = Rp 3.000");
while (keputusan.equals("Y")||keputusan.equals("y"))
{
System.out.print("Pilih dengan memasukan angka yang tersedia pada menu = ");
int pil = input.nextInt();
if (pil==1){
menu[i] = "obeng";
harga[i] = 12000;
} else if (pil==2) {
menu[i]= "tang kecil";
harga[i] = 9500;
} else if (pil==3) {
menu[i]="mata bor";
harga[i] = 7000;
} else if (pil==4) {
menu[i]= "tang ukuran sedang";
harga[i] = 14000;
} else if (pil==5) {
menu[i]= "skrup";
harga[i] = 3000;
} else if (pil==6) {
menu[i]= "bor";
harga[i] = 80000;
} else if (pil==7) {
menu[i]= "obeng listrik";
harga[i] = 35000;
} else if (pil==8) {
menu[i]= "kunci inggris";
harga[i] = 40000;
} else if (pil==9) {
menu[i]= "gergaji";
harga[i] = 10000;
} else if (pil==10) {
menu[i]= "batu bata";
harga[i] = 3000;
} else {
System.out.println("Maaf barang yang anda pilih tidak tersedia ");
menu[i]= "Tidak Ada";
}
System.out.println("barang yang anda pesan adalah : "+menu[i]);
System.out.println("Yang harus anda bayar adalah : "+harga[i]);
System.out.print("Apakah anda ingin membeli lagi ? Y/T : ");
try{
keputusan = input2.readLine();
}catch(IOException e){
System.out.println("Gagal Membaca Keyboard");
}
i++;
}
System.out.println("Menu yang anda pesan adalah : "+i);
for (int a = 0; a<i;a++){
System.out.print(menu[a]+", ");
}
for (int b = 0; b<i;b++){
hargatotal = hargatotal + harga[b];
}
System.out.println("Total yang harus anda bayar adalah : Rp."+hargatotal);
}
}


Komentar
Posting Komentar